How can one avoid getting tired while playing a tennis match?

In order to avoid getting tired during a tennis match, it is crucial to prioritize recovery and refocus during points. With just 25 seconds between each point, using this time wisely can greatly enhance your mental state and stamina throughout the game. By taking deep breaths, visualizing successful shots, and clearing your mind of any distractions, you can rejuvenate your energy levels and maintain a high performance level on the court.

The key to not feeling fatigued during a tennis match lies in effectively managing the brief breaks between points. Utilizing the 25-second interval to recharge mentally and physically can make a significant difference in your overall endurance and performance. By employing techniques such as controlled breathing, mental imagery, and staying focused on the task at hand, you can ensure that your energy remains optimal and fatigue stays at bay, allowing you to excel in each and every point of the match.

How can one maintain high energy levels throughout a tennis match?

Staying energized during a tennis match is crucial to maintain your performance on the court. One effective way to boost your energy levels is by having a snack. While a banana is a popular choice, it may take some time to provide the desired energy. Opting for dates, on the other hand, can offer an instant release of energy. Dates are rich in carbohydrates and provide an optimal amount of fiber, making them an ideal snack for quick and sustained energy during a match.

In addition to snacking, it is important to stay hydrated throughout the tennis match. Dehydration can lead to fatigue and decreased performance. Drinking water or sports drinks at regular intervals will help replenish the fluids and electrolytes lost through sweating. Keeping a water bottle handy and taking quick sips during breaks or changeovers will help maintain your energy levels and overall performance on the court.

What is the reason for feeling tired while playing tennis?

When you find yourself feeling exhausted after playing tennis, there is a scientific explanation behind it. This fatigue can be attributed to the depletion of muscle glycogen and low blood glucose levels. It is especially noticeable during prolonged periods of exercise, particularly when playing tennis for more than 90 minutes. Understanding the relationship between these factors can help you better manage your energy levels and optimize your performance on the court.

Playing tennis for an extended duration can leave you feeling drained due to the depletion of muscle glycogen and low blood glucose levels. These energy sources are crucial for sustained physical activity, and when they are depleted, fatigue sets in. This is particularly evident when playing tennis for more than 90 minutes, as the body’s energy reserves are gradually exhausted. By being aware of these factors and taking steps to replenish muscle glycogen and blood glucose levels, you can combat tiredness and ensure that your tennis sessions are both enjoyable and energizing.
